- Assist attorneys in all stages of litigation cases from onset through post-trial. Ascertaining calendaring deadlines will be a significant aspect of the role.
- Conduct legal research using tools such as Lexis and Westlaw to support case preparation.
- Draft and prepare legal documents such as pleadings, briefs, motions, subpoenas, and discovery responses.
- Review, organize and maintain document databases for litigation matters, including managing large amounts of data, production documents, and other evidence for use at trial.
- Assist with trial preparation including witness lists, exhibits, and trial binders. Prepare for and attend trials, managing exhibits and all other trial support.
- Efficiently maintain and update the case management system, deposition database Opus2, and relativity database.
- Coordinate and manage routine court appearances on behalf of attorneys.
- Conduct cite checks for legal briefs and memoranda.
- Coordinate and assist with depositions, including preparation of witness files, scheduling depositions, and handling of all related details.
